Javoricko

The underground system of the Javoříčko Caves consists of a complex of corridors, domes and abysses. The main part of the caves was discovered during several hours of demanding travel through the lower level as far back as 1938, and other sections were gradually discovered in the 1950s. Currently, more than 3.5 kilometers of corridors are known, of which 788 meters are open to the public.

The caves have beautiful dripstone decorations, the richness of which excels in two monumental spaces: the Detritus Cave and the Cave of Giants. In addition to the most common types of dripstone decoration, there is also a rich occurance of helictites, which are dripstones that grow in defiance of the laws of gravity.
